anyways lets move away from it for the moment because its pointless to dwell when we have so much game left to play. Can we talk about setup for a moment? Im trying to figure out exactly how the setup is determined and dont really understand the dicerolling aspects
 
Town Power Roles:

To determine the town power roles, roll a die six times and mark down the numbers. Each roll corresponds to a grouping below.

1-3: Investigative
4-5: Protective
6: Killing


----------

so you are rolling to determine the categories of the power roles, but then how are the actual power roles decided?

you roll six d6's so I think there would be 3 town power roles in a game? one dice to determine the category and the next to pick what role from each category

ex;

Investigative
1Innocent Child
2Role Oracle
3Role Cop
4Tracker
5Parity Cop
6Cop (with Night 0 peek)
 
or are the numbers the actual instances of the roll?

so like the first three times you roll you are rolling for investigative, the next two for protective etc

I don't think there would be six town power rolls because the OP says mafia would have (town prs-1) power roles.
 
yeah i think if I rolled these numbers for town; 3, 1, 5, 2, 6, 4

what town would have are; innocent child, doctor, vigilante, 7 vts

then id roll for scum lets say I roll 5 and 2

what scum would have are tracker, roleblocker, goon.
